Abstract
Plant phenology is determined by phases that mark the appearance or disappearance of vegetative and reproductive organs, such as the appearance of plants, the appearance of buds, flowers and fruits. Thus, the present study aimed to evaluate the phenological behavior of Physalis peruviana L. grown in a greenhouse in the city of São Mateus - ES, verifying whether its production is feasible under the conditions presented. The experimental design used was completely randomized, totaling 34 plants, with treatments consisting of days after transplanting. The plant's conduction system was single-stemmed. The spacing used between the plants was triangular (0.55m x 0.55m x 1m). For the observation of phenophases, it was considered when 30% of the plants were in the following stages: Stage 1 - True Leaves; Phase 2 - Flower buds; Step 3 - Open flowers; Step 4 - Immature fruits; and Step 5 - Ripe fruits. At the end of the experiment, the following evaluations were performed: number of leaves, plant height, stem diameter, number of flower buds, number of flowers and number of fruits per plant. The averages were compared using the Scott-Knott test at 5% probability. The results showed that it is possible to produce Physalis peruviana L. under the conditions defined in a greenhouse in the region of São Mateus-ES, the crop showed good development in the vegetative, flowering and fruiting phases, starting the harvest 60 days after transplant.
